/*
 * Fixture: cron-drift-repro.json
 * Captures the Wrenfield scheduler state from the night drift exceeded 90s.
 * The fixture replays four ticks with a skewed monotonic clock so the
 * compensator logic can be asserted deterministically. Do not regenerate
 * by hand; use scripts/capture_drift.sh against staging. Replaying against
 * the staging scheduler requires authenticating with the bearer token below.
 */

session JWT of yawep-yawep = eyJhbGciOiJIUzI1NiIsInR5cCI6IkpXVCJ9.eyJzdWIiOiI3pWF3_In0.aXYsHiog

### Q2 Planning Note — Marketing Budget Adjustment

Branch managers: corporate has approved a 14% reduction in discretionary marketing spend across the Velmont Group network, effective next quarter. Print campaigns for the Orisa line end first; digital spend through the Pellbright platform continues at current levels. Please review your local commitments carefully and flag any contractual exposure by Friday. The restricted note on broader business plans follows immediately below.

board note of kageg-bahof: The renewal with Holwynax Holdings closes at $2 million a year, 5 percent below the last contract. Project Ulaath slips by two quarters because of the supplier delay.

## Changelog — Font vendoring defaults changed

As of this release, the Bracken UI build no longer fetches third-party fonts at build time. All typefaces used by the Lanternwell suite are now vendored into the repo under a dedicated assets directory, and the fetch step is skipped by default. If you're onboarding, nothing to install — the fonts travel with the checkout. The build flags controlling this behavior are listed below.

settings of hadup-yafog:
LAMAEL_PIN=3761
LAMAEL_TENANT=istmir
LAMAEL_METRICS_HOST=metrics.lamael.plorvasys.test
LAMAEL_SEAL=seal_8ea68500
LAMAEL_STANDBY_TEAM=fraok

## Further Reading

Currency conversion in Coinlathe rounds at the final step, not per line item — otherwise attackers could farm half-cents by splitting orders. We use banker's rounding and store amounts as integer minor units throughout. If you're reviewing the math, focus on the refund path, which historically drifted. The full rounding policy and threat notes are on the internal page.

runbook for hawif-tajeg: https://grafana.plorvasoft.example/dash